Bandari Laxmi v. The State Of Telangana,
THE HONOURABLE SRI JUSTICE SANJAY KUMAR WRIT PETITION NO.2695 OF 2019
O R D E R
The grievance of the petitioner is that the Tahsildar, Kalvasrirampur Mandal, Peddapalli District, is not issuing her e-patta pass books in respect of the land admeasuring Ac.2.00 guntas in Survey No.43/A1; Ac.1.00 guntas in Survey No.43/A2; and Ac.1.00 guntas in Survey No.66/A of Pagadapalli Village, Kalvasrirampur Mandal, Peddapalli District.
Perusal of the record reflects that the petitioner was already issued a regular pattadar pass book under the provisions of the Telangana Rights in Land and Pattadar Pass Books Act, 1971 in relation to the subject land. That being so, the Tahsildar, Kalvasrirampur Mandal, Peddapalli District, is bound to consider her request for issuance of e-patta pass books in relation to the very same land. However, as the representation said to have been made by the petitioner is not placed on record, the writ petition is disposed of permitting the petitioner to make an application afresh in prescribed format to the Tahsildar, Kalvasrirampur Mandal, Peddapalli District, requesting him to issue e-patta pass books in relation to the subject land. As and when such an application is made, the Tahsildar, Kalvasrirampur Mandal, Peddapalli District, shall take appropriate action thereon expeditiously and in any event, not later than four weeks from the date of receipt of such application. Pending miscellaneous petitions shall stand closed in the light of this final order. No order as to costs.
